A key challenge is the pervasive deployment of LBC technologies; to be effective they must run on a wide variety of client platforms, including laptops, PDAs, and mobile phones, so that location data can be acquired anywhere and accessed by any application. Moreover, as a nascent area, LBC is experiencing rapid innovation in sensing technologies, the positioning algorithms themselves, and the applications they support. Lastly, as a newcomer, LBC must integrate with existing communications and application technologies, including web browsers and location data interchange standard.This paper describes our experience in developing the Place Lab architecture, a widely used first-generation open source toolkit for client-side location sensing. Using a layered, pattern-based architecture, it supports modular development in any dimension of LBC, enabling the field to move forward more rapidly as these innovations are shared with the community as pluggable components. Our experience shows the benefits of domain-specific abstractions, and how we overcame high-level language constraints to support a wide array of platforms in this emerging space. When considering whether to adopt an agile or plan-driven project management strategy in a commercial context, Return On Investment (ROI) is an important factor. We have adapted the ROI model to our analysis to assess what affect a chosen development approach has on the outcome of the groups' projects. In our investigation we observed seven software teams as they implemented a business information system. Two groups adopted agile practices, including fortnightly iterative delivery; the other groups were controls. We found that being labelled agile did not necessarily imply that a group's practices were more agile. To provide users with smart computational services, these applications must be aware of incessant context changes in their environments and adjust their behaviors accordingly. As these environments are highly dynamic and noisy, context changes thus acquired could be obsolete, corrupted or inaccurate. This gives rise to the problem of context inconsistency, which must be timely detected in order to prevent applications from behaving anomalously. In this paper, we propose a formal model of incremental consistency checking for pervasive contexts. Based on this model, we further propose an efficient checking algorithm to detect inconsistent contexts. A few of these transformations have been mechanised in interactive development environments. Many more refactorings have been proposed, and it would be desirable for programmers to script their own refactorings. Implementing such source-to-source transformations, however, is quite complex: even the most sophisticated development environments contain significant bugs in their refactoring tools.We present a domain-specific language for refactoring, named JunGL. It manipulates a graph representation of the program: all information about the program, including ASTs for its compilation units, variable binding, control flow and so on is represented in a uniform graph format. The language is a hybrid of a functional language (in the style of ML) and a logic query language (akin to Datalog). JunGL furthermore has a notion of demand-driven evaluation for constructing computed information in the graph, such as control flow edges. By using this framework, Java AWT applications can be executed on a server and their graphical interfaces can be displayed on a remote client. Compared to other popular paradigms, CBSD supports the development from reusable components other than the development from the scratch. Consequently, modeling becomes more important than programming and the modeling techniques in traditional paradigms have to be changed more or less. Particularly, improper selection and misuse of modeling techniques would prevent the target system from benefiting from CBSD and even make the project fail. For helping researchers and practitioners to equip with CBSD, this tutorial will provide basic knowledge and skill of modeling component based systems systematically. Firstly, we will introduce the technical and non-technical motivations of CBSD with emphasis on software reuse which puts a significant impact on modeling. Secondly, we will present a systematic approach to modeling component based systems with a set of existing well-proved modeling techniques, including feature modeling for requirements specification, architecture modeling for abstract design, and object oriented modeling for detailed design.
